Where to Buy Items Online

Shopping online is a convenient way to buy items. It's important to select the right website that provides good customer service. It also helps to know whether the company's website is secure.

Some websites specialize in a particular product. Fashionphile for instance, sells designer bags of the past as well as pre-loved items, while Etsy has a broad selection of handmade goods.

Auction sites

Auction sites online allow users to buy and sell products and services via the process of bidding. These auctions cover everything from electronics, collectibles as well as real estate or even freelance work. The auction ends with the highest bidder. Some auction sites have specific categories and limit the kinds of objects that can be sold and others offer an open marketplace.

Most auction sites require users create an account with a username and password which must be kept private. This stops unauthorised buyers and sellers from or selling goods without the knowledge of the buyer. Auction sites may check the authenticity of buyers and sellers. This involves checking the user's name and address, as well as reviewing their ratings and transactions history.

Check for these features when selecting an auction site: Push notifications Notify buyers if they've been outbid, or when an auction finishes. A watchlist lets buyers keep track of their most-loved items and sellers. A variety of payment options Accepts credit cards, PayPal, and other popular payment methods.

A site's monetization model is another aspect to consider. Some sites charge a listing fee, while others charge a percentage of the final sale price. You should carefully weigh the various monetization options to make sure you choose the best one for your company.

Sites that are market-specific

Some online shopping websites focus on specific markets, like furniture, fashion or toys. They offer a broad selection of products from multiple sellers and offer a single shop for customers. A lot of these sites offer comparison shopping services, which help customers find the best deals on a specific product. Price aggregation websites are useful, as they collect prices from different retailers and report an average price. Before purchasing a product from an unfamiliar online retailer, make sure you check the site's professionalism and user-friendliness. Check if it lists a telephone number or street address with an e-contact and if it has an acceptable and fair refund and return policy.
